Transaction 81ddc44e5102d20f71833ac48682f48b6e25124795aced4bbbcecfbc67b668e6
1 Input
1 Output
-
81ddc44e5102d20f71833ac48682f48b6e25124795aced4bbbcecfbc67b668e6:0
- value
- 437916
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cebbbfb297918e00052ea3f583bc021f87f74ea OP_EQUAL
- address
- 32sLRxB9gvHvNmGJGKeK9RrUwQdEDaYj9r